Merry March Mysteries

missing page info 2018

lighthearted mysterious fast-paced

missing page info digital 2019

lighthearted mysterious fast-paced

258 pages paperback

fiction mystery lighthearted mysterious medium-paced

244 pages paperback

fiction mystery

250 pages paperback

fiction mystery

234 pages paperback

fiction mystery

262 pages paperback

fiction mystery lighthearted mysterious medium-paced